Edition Notes

8 engraved emblems (49 x 49 mm.)

Chronograms for 1717 and anagrams featured throughout text.

Dedication signed Petrus Vander Borcht.

Provenance: Bookplate of John Landwehr.

Landwehr, J. Emblem and fable books printed in the Low Countries, 1542-1813, 41.
